Setting Up Your Venmo to Bank Transfer

To initiate a transfer from Venmo to your bank account, you must first ensure that your bank account is linked to your Venmo profile. This is a critical step as it enables the secure movement of funds between the two entities.

·        Link Your Bank Account: Open the Venmo app, navigate to the "You" tab, then click on "Settings" and select "Payment Methods." Tap "Add a bank or card" and choose "Bank." You can add your bank account either manually by entering your account information or through instant verification using your banking login credentials.

·        Verify Your Bank Account: If you've added your bank account manually, Venmo will make two small deposits into your bank account, which you will need to verify in the Venmo app to confirm the link.

 

Executing a Transfer from Venmo to Your Bank Account

Once your bank account is linked and verified, you can proceed to transfer funds.

·        Access the Transfer Menu: In the Venmo app, tap the single person icon to reach your personal transactions page, then click on the "Manage Balance" option at the top right corner.

·        Enter the Transfer Details: Choose the "Transfer to Bank" option. Enter the amount you wish to transfer. Venmo allows you to transfer any amount from Venmo balance to your linked bank account.

·        Select Transfer Speed: Venmo offers two speed options for transferring funds:

·        Instant Transfer: Funds typically arrive in your bank account within 30 minutes. A fee (1% of the transfer amount, capped at $10) is charged for this convenience.

·        Standard Transfer: This method is free and funds will arrive in your bank account within 1 to 3 business days, depending on your bank’s processing time.

·        Review and Confirm the Transfer: Double-check the transfer details, including the amount and destination bank account. Confirm the transfer to initiate the process. You will receive a notification once the transfer is complete.

 

Security Measures and Tips

While transferring money from Venmo to a bank account is generally secure, it is crucial to observe certain practices to ensure safety and efficiency:

·        Secure Your Venmo Account: Use a strong, unique password for your Venmo account and enable multifactor authentication to add an extra layer of security.

·        Monitor Transaction History: Regularly review your transaction history for any unauthorized transactions. Report any suspicious activity immediately.

·        Public and Private Settings: Understand the implications of Venmo’s social sharing features. Adjust your privacy settings to control who sees your transactions.
